Roasted salmonIngredients:4 (thin) salmon fillets1 tablespoon oil100 gr dill butter
extra:baking oven or barbeque |

Preparation in advance:Make the dill butter. Keep 1 tablespoon apart and make of the rest a roll, using aluminium foil (wrap up like a candy). Place the roll in the fridge.How to prepare:Coat the salmon fillet with the oil and roast both sides shortly under the broiler or on the barbecue till the surface of the salmon is sealed.Brush some of the kept back dill butter over and let the salmon broil a little further of the grill. Total time is 8-10 minutes.Frozen fillets can be used half thawed.Put the salmon on a plate, cut the dill butter in thin slices and arrange the slices on the fish.
